Description

Being offered with NO ONWARD CHAIN and located close to the Naze and Beach within WALTON-ON-THE-NAZE we have the pleasure in marketing this FOUR DOUBLE BEDROOM TOWN HOUSE. Internally the Ground Floor is home to a Lounge, Cloakroom and L-shaped Kitchen/Diner with French doors onto the Garden. On the First Floor is Two Double Bedrooms and Family Bathroom whilst the Second Floor has two more Double Bedrooms and En-suite to the Master. Externally there is a Front Garden, Rear Garden and Parking for two vehicles located at the rear.
